It’s beginning to look a lot like Christmas and Home Instead Senior Care is spreading some holiday cheer. A few weeks back, the organization kicked off their ‘Be a Santa to a Senior’ initiative. This allows seniors in the community to receive items they want/need this holiday season.
“We get senior adults' names from organizations that are in Meridian and the surrounding area,” said Owner of Home Instead Senior Care Charrisa Shirley. “They send a list of needs that they want or that they need--things that they could use in their home or just a physical body.”
Once that list of names come in, each name is written on a light bulb and placed on the Christmas tree for those in the community to choose from.
“What you do is, you get the gifts--we make bulbs and it has the name and then the needs on the back. You never get to meet your person, but as you come in, you get a bulb, take it home and buy the items and you bring them back in a box. After that, we mark them off, wrap them, then call the organization that gave us the name, they come by and get it and then deliver it to the client that is listed on the bulb.”

The organization recently held a drive through pickup for names of seniors, but they still have a few left on the tree to hand out. Shirley says they have already begun receiving gifts, but want to make sure other seniors still get their Christmas wish as well.
“Just come and support senior adults and be able to give back to those that cannot buy for themselves and do not feel comfortable getting out and about," said Shirley.
Shirley says they will be distributing light bulbs until they run out. They will also have another drive through pick up for those who still want to participate. Home Instead Senior Care is located at 4525 Poplar Springs Drive, Meridian, MS. For more information, visit beasantatoasenior.com.
